Paxton on call for Phelan to resign: 'He has proven himself unworthy of Texans' trust and incapable of leading the Texas House'

Texas House Speaker Dade Phelan (R-Beaumont) faces a call to resign from Texas Attorney General (TXAG) Ken Paxton in response to alleged drunken behavior on the floor of the lower chamber of the state legislature.


'Houston's first-ever Medal of Valor recipient': White House honors officer who prevented shooting at Galleria

A Houston police officer visited the White House on Thursday where President Joe Biden bestowed upon him the country’s highest honor for bravery displayed by a public safety officer.

Griner on WNBA return: 'Part of the process of healing is just kind of letting it out'

Houston native and Phoenix Mercury star Brittney Griner may have spent a year away from the Women’s National Basketball Association (WNBA), but her performance on Sunday in front of her home crowd showed she hasn’t lost a step.

Friendswood Independent School District on cancellation of outdoor activities for remainder of 2022-2023 year: 'Our students and staff's safety and well-being are always our top priority'

A suburban Houston public school district announced on Monday it has canceled recess and all outdoor activities for the remainder of the current academic year, per a report from Houston ABC affiliate KTRK.
